关于push进入下一页,底部tabbar隐藏的小问题

来源:互联网 发布:整体衣柜软件 编辑:程序博客网 时间:2024/06/05 02:42

今天遇到一个问题,简单描述下,A页面push进B页面,在B页面的storyboard里,我设置了hide bottom bar when push,B中,在tabbar位置上有个button,然后运行发现,当进入B的瞬间,B中的button一开始并没有在tabbar的位置上,而是稍偏上,也就是0.5秒左右的时间,B中的button按照约束来到了tabbar的位置,经过调试在B中的viewwillappear里写上tabbar.hidden = true的代码,就好了。


分析猜测下原因:storyboard里调用这个hide bottom bar when push方法应该发生在viewillappear之后,换句话说,当我们进入B的瞬间看到的界面,tabbar还未被hide,在layout调用后,才hide,所以会出现问题描述中,button会有位移的动作。。。

0 0
原创粉丝点击